Question

cos(62)=4/x
Solve for x. Round to the nearest tenth.

To solve for x, we need to isolate x on one side of the equation. We can do this by multiplying both sides by x:

x * cos(62) = 4

To isolate x, we need to divide both sides of the equation by cos(62):

x = 4 / cos(62)

Using a calculator, we can find that cos(62) is approximately 0.46630765815.

x = 4 / 0.46630765815 ≈ 8.58

Rounding to the nearest tenth, x ≈ 8.6
